Book Synopsis
Page 1
The character of Greg Donovan, named in honor of my younger sibling, first appeared in the short story, “Transport,” in which a young man, not reaching his full potential in academics, signs on as a Cargo Liaison on a futuristic cargo ship serving the Mars colonies. His uncommon love of diagrams and schematics works in his favor. First published in the book, “Kellerman’s Five of a Kind.”

Page 31
His second time at bat was in “Spacesex,” a libidinous tale of sex and murder on a space station with five thousand inhabitants. Just as ill intent and sex seem to exist everywhere, a space station if no exception. An adjunct tale in the book, “Precipice.” Not a tale to be shared with the kids.

Page 53
Now an accomplished Security Chief, the still young Greg Donovan is ordered to the Moon’s first science colony, Moon Base Delta, where even on a distant body in space, murder comes calling. In “Murder at Moon Base Delta,” how does a man with a perfect alibi commit murder? Featured in the sci-fi short story book, “Three to Get Ready.”
